Quick Glance: Poland recalls Eurocorps leader amidst inquiry
- Following an investigation by the Polish Military Counterintelligence Service (SKW), Poland has removed the commander of the Eurocorps.
- The defense ministry announced on Wednesday afternoon that Gromadziński was recalled from Strasbourg immediately due to inspection proceedings initiated by the SKW regarding his security clearance.
- Subsequently, Lieutenant General Piotr Błazeusz was appointed as Gromadziński’s replacement to lead the Eurocorps.
- Reports suggested that EU and NATO allies were not informed in advance of Gromadziński’s recall, a claim refuted by Poland’s current defense minister, Władysław Kosiniak-Kamysz.

Quick Glance: Northern Lights Potential Display Over UK Tonight
- The Met Office has announced that the Northern Lights could be visible across northern parts of the UK tonight. This phenomenon, also known as Aurora Borealis, usually appears above Iceland and Norway but is rarely visible from the UK, mostly limited to Scotland.
- According to the Met Office, a combination of fast solar winds and the recent arrival of a coronal mass ejection from the sun could trigger a display from Sunday evening to Monday morning. The Northern Lights are created by particles from the sun carried on solar winds interacting with the Earth's atmosphere after being directed to the polar regions by the planet's magnetic field.
- Different gases have varying effects on the color of the display. Green signifies solar particles interacting with oxygen, while purple, blue, or pink hues are a result of nitrogen. Only under 'severe space weather conditions' can the lights be visible throughout the UK - even then, stargazers require a clear sky and reduced light pollution.

Quick Glance: Significant Donations for Biden at Election Fundraiser in NYC
- A fundraising event for President Joe Biden in New York City, featuring Barack Obama and Bill Clinton, raised an impressive $25 million, setting a record for the highest fundraising amount for a political gathering, according to his campaign.
- The upcoming event at Radio City Music Hall will serve as a prominent highlight following a recent series of campaign travels by the president. Biden's visits to various political battlegrounds in the weeks since his State of the Union address have emphasized his bid for reelection. Furthermore, the event will bring together more than thirty years of Democratic leadership.
- With varying levels of access based on donors' generosity, the event will feature a significant aspect, an on-stage discussion among the three presidents, moderated by late-night host Stephen Colbert. Additionally, a lineup of musical talents, including Queen Latifah, Lizzo, Ben Platt, Cynthia Erivo, and Lea Michele, will be hosted by actress Mindy Kaling. Attendance is expected to be high, with ticket prices starting as low as $225.
- The support of Obama and Clinton is assisting Biden in further strengthening his substantial financial lead over Trump. As of the end of February, Biden had $155 million in available funds, in contrast to Trump's $37 million and his Save America political action committee.

Quick Glance: New Report: Kenya Ranks 114th in Happiness Index
- For the seventh consecutive year, Finland has secured the title of the world's happiest country, with Kenya ranking 114th out of a total of 143 countries. Conversely, Afghanistan finds itself at the bottom of the ranking as the unhappiest nation.
- The latest findings were unveiled on March 20, 2024, coinciding with the International Day of Happiness.
- This annual report relies on six key factors, encompassing social support, income, health, freedom, generosity, and absence of corruption. The economic dimension serves as a pivotal gauge for happiness levels across different nations.

Quick Glance: Robinho Arrested in Brazil for Rape Conviction
- Former footballer Robinho was arrested in Brazil after his last-minute attempt to delay his nine-year rape sentence was rejected.
- Robinho was found guilty by an Italian court for participating in a gang rape and exhausted all appeals.
- Italy requested Robinho to serve his sentence in Brazil since the country does not extradite its nationals.
- Criticism arose in the football world over the silence on cases of violence against women, especially with Robinho and Dani Alves' convictions.

Quick Glance: India Celebrates Hindu Holi Festival with Colorful Traditions
- Millions of Indians celebrated the Hindu Holi festival by smearing colored powder, exchanging traditional foods, and drinks.
- The festival marks the beginning of spring and celebrates the divine love between Krishna and Radha.
- Traditions like consuming Bhang, a cannabis-infused drink, and lighting large fires are part of the festivities.
- Various Holi traditions in India, such as the 'Lathmar Holi' in northern towns, showcase the diversity of celebrations.

Quick Glance: Trump Struggles with Bail and Frustration Grows
- Donald Trump and some members of his inner circle are frustrated by the prospect of him failing to post the $464 million civil fraud penalty by Monday's deadline.
- Trump is urgently seeking campaign funds and potential guarantors for his bail to prevent New York Attorney General Letitia James from seizing his assets.
- Trump's defense team is considering options to challenge the judgment without posting bail and speculating on the impact of asset seizure on his campaign.
- Despite concerns from his team regarding bail, Trump's campaign is leveraging the situation to mobilize supporters and reinforce the perception of unfair treatment by the justice system.

Quick Glance: Controlled Release by April 1: After Weeks of Debate - Cannabis Legalization Approved by Bundesrat
- Cannabis legalization has passed the Bundesrat, despite resistance from some federal states.
- The law allows possession and cultivation of cannabis with specific regulations starting April 1.
- Health Minister Lauterbach sees the legalization as an opportunity to combat the black market.
- Certain politicians caution against negative consequences such as increased deaths due to risky cannabis consumption.
